Description
The federal government is building a dam. And Donald Dixon is building a bomb. It's Summer 1991 in the small north Georgia town of Haynesville. Residents in the path of the new lake, or "flood zone," have all been relocated to higher ground - except for Donald, who refuses to leave his ancestral farm home.
When a teenage bootlegger stumbles upon Donald's diabolical scheme, he pairs up with an opioid-addicted federal government employee to try and stop it. While the three men find themselves at violent odds, each shares a dark past that ties them together.
Frank Reddy is the author of the 2016 novel, Eyes on the Island, a critically-acclaimed Southern Gothic thriller that garnered praise from The Atlanta Journal-Constitution, Creative Loafing and numerous online critics. He lives in Atlanta, Ga., with his young daughter and son.
